Ruston, La. – Louisiana Tech offensive lineman
Joshua Mote has been invited to minicamp by the Kansas City Chiefs and Seattle Seahawks.
Mote, a 6-2 307-pound offensive lineman, appeared in 50 games while making over 35 starts during his Louisiana Tech career.
During his time in Ruston, Mote was a standout on the Bulldogs' offensive line, garnering All-Conference USA Honorable Mention selections in 2020, 2021 and 2022.
Mote helped anchor an offensive line that played a large role in the Bulldogs' passing offense, which ranked 32nd nationally at 267.2 yards a contest in 2022. He had PFF pass-blocking grades of over 80 in six games last season and paved the way for seven 100-plus-yard rushing games.
The Oak Grove, La., product also excelled in the classroom and off the field. Mote was a nominee for the Wuerffel Trophy in 2022 and has been named to the Conference USA Commissioner's Honor Roll five times. He also received the C-USA Spirit of Service Award in 2020.
